
A hydraulic circuit is a group of components such as pumps, actuators, control valves, conductors and fittings arranged to perform useful work. There are three important considerations in designing a …
The task of hydraulic circuit design is using hydraulic components to configure a system which is able to move or act on the given physical system in the desired fashion.

When analyzing or Designing a Hydraulic Circuit, the following Three Important Considerations must be taken into account: Safety of Operation, Performance of desired Function, and Efficiency of Operation.
